High voltage pulse circuit for X-rays tube grid control

Description

This work deals with a high voltage pulse circuit for X-rays tube grid control. An alternating current is provided to a charging circuit. The charging circuit provides an electrical charge to an output transformer. The output of the transformer is connected across a diode bridge. Each side of the bridge has two diodes connected in series. The output from the diode bridge passes to a capacitance charging a capacitor for the required time interval at a high voltage. A Zener diode regulates the high voltage and dissipates surplus energy. Output from the capacitance is passed to the X-ray tube grid. This circuit provides short high voltage and can then be used in X-ray machines for cardio-vascular examinations. (authors). 6 figs
